In every prosperous business lies strong first-line leadership. First-line managers play a crucial role, acting as the link between upper management and staff members.

A proficient first-line manager transforms business goals into practical plans, thus accelerating the development of your company. Thus, understanding how crucial this role is to business growth gives an indispensable guide for overall success.

Competent first-line managers possess a raft of skills. Critical among these is outstanding dialogue. Whether communicating your company's goals to your workforce, or hearing and understanding their anxieties, efficient communication skill is required.

Likewise, first-line managers should be exemplary problem solvers. Complications will inevitably arise, and it is the leader's responsibility to manage these challenges efficiently, turning possible roadblocks into opportunities for growth.

Moreover, a great first-line manager requires outstanding organizational skills. This necessitates an ability to see the "big picture", as well as a detailed attention to detail.

Also, being a first-line manager requires excellent people skills. Managers should be capable of build strong relationships with their team, establishing a supportive work environment.

Putting efforts in first-line manager development is a wise decision for any company seeking improvement. It ensures the correct implementation of your company's vision and plan, leading to a more effective and profitable business.

Overall, a qualified first-line manager is necessary to ensure your business's growth. By grasping the value of this role, and investing in those who fill it, your organization can see noteworthy growth and success.
